Abstract

This paper is focused on veri cation of decision making behaviour performed in multiagent system using model checking which is an automatic technique based on formal methods used for verifying the nite state system. This study explores multi-agent system consisted of ground control system, unmanned aerial vehicle, and unmanned ground vehicle and uses Kripke model to describe the decision-making behaviour of the multi-agent system. System properties to be veri ed are expressed in computational temporal logic. Finally, simulations showed that model checker for multi-agent systems automatically veri ed the multi-agent system considered in this study.
